Résumé

The AquiFR project aims at taking benefits of existing groundwater modeling applications used bystakeholders to develop new products in order to provide useful information for water resourcesmanagement. Indeed, it aims at providing forecasts of the groundwater resources at10 days aheadupto seasonal scale. In its present form, the AquiFR system includes 3 hydrogeological modelscovering 8 multilayers sedimentary aquifers and 10 karstic aquifers. These applications wereassembled within a coupling system facilitating the parallel computation and coupled to a land surfacemodel used in the French numerical weather model that provides the recharge. The whole system isexpected to run operationally at Meteo France. To do so, a real time application will be run daily forcedby an analysis of the observed atmospheric conditions. This real time simulation will then be able toprovide initial conditions for the forecasts. Ensemble 10-day forecast will then be run daily, andseasonal forecasts will be run monthly. The monitoring and the forecasts could be compared to thelong term reanalysis of the groundwater that is being built by using an atmospheric reanalysis.
